1. Water-Resistant Grease: Protect Against Moisture
In industries exposed to water, steam, or humidity, standard grease often fails. This leads to:
-
Grease washout during cleaning or weather changes.
-
Corrosion and rust on metal surfaces.
-
Frequent reapplication, increasing downtime and labour costs.
ACE OEL Water-Resistant Grease is specially formulated to resist washout, fight corrosion, and maintain the right viscosity in wet environments. The result? Longer service intervals, lower maintenance costs, and higher equipment uptime.
2. Open Gear Grease: Reliable Protection in Harsh Conditions
Open gears operate under heavy loads, dust, and extreme temperatures. Using general-purpose grease can cause:
-
Metal-to-metal wear due to lack of pressure additives.
-
Poor adhesion, leaving gears unprotected.
-
Higher energy costs from friction and efficiency loss.
ACE OEL Open Gear Grease is engineered with extreme-pressure additives and tackiness agents. It creates a strong lubrication film that stays in place, even under severe conditions. This means longer gear life, reduced power consumption, and fewer unplanned breakdowns.
